WebOct 24, 2024 · Pulmonary cryptococcal infection can often be asymptomatic in patients, or present with low-grade, non-specific respiratory symptoms. Patients with cryptococcal pneumonia often experience cough, chest pains, low-grade fever, malaise, and shortness of breath. Trehalose-6-phosphate synthase (Tps1) converts UDP-glucose and … WebNon- neoformans cryptococci have been generally regarded as saprophytes and rarely reported as human pathogens. However, the incidence of infection due to these organisms has increased over the past 40 years, with Cryptococcus laurentii and Cryptococcus albidus, together, responsible for 80% of reported cases.
